A huge congratulations to former Cadet, Bella Low who has been awarded The League of Mercy's Distinguished Community Service Medal for Cadets.

The former Cadet Corporal has been awarded the medal for her outstanding life saving First Aid treatment to a member of the public and also for delivering First Aid to a fellow Cadet.

Cdt Cpl Low, who is one out of only five Cadets Nationally to be given such an award, will be presented with her medal at a prestigious event in London later this year.

20220705 133232 0000

When asked what are your thoughts on receiving this award, (Former) Cdt Cpl Low said:

"Wow, it was a suprise to me, but I was more grateful that both people I treated have made a full recovery from their injuries."

Cdt Cpl Low's former Detachment Commander SMI Alan Herbert told us:

"Bella Low deserves recognition for her actions in both incidents, many would have walked away or not known what to do. Truly wonderful to see former Cdt Cpl Low receive recognition for her First Aid skills, a huge congratulations from all of us at Allerton Detachment."

Merseyside Army Cadet Force Commandant, Colonel David Seddon (ACF) has said:

"Cdt Cpl Bella Low is not just a fantastic Cadet but an outstanding person. Bella has on numerous occasions stepped in and given First Aid in very challenging situations showing a calm and considered approach far beyond her age. Former Cdt Cpl Low is a credit to herself, her family and truly reflects what the Army Cadet Forces represents.

Congratulations and well deserved and all of us at Merseyside ACF wish Bella good luck with whatever her future brings."
